TITt.E: Condenser-dischar8e Welding of Bicycle Frdmes
(Kondensat6rnaya
svarka velosipednykh ram)
PERIODICAL: Tekhnol,. avtomobilestroyeniya, 1958, Nr 2, pp 36-41
ABSTRACT: The novel technological process of condenser -
discharge welding
(CW) of permanently joined members of bicycle frames developed by
the NIlTavtoprom (Scientific Research Institute of Technology
for the
Automobil-c Industry) substantidlly reduces the amount of lab'or
required as well as the weight of the bicycles. The employment
of the
CW significantly reduces the consumption of ferrous and
nonferrous
metals and auxiliary materials dnd eliminates such operations as
the manufacture of fittings, their attachment. etc. The
electrical
circuitry of GW is examined. Technical specifications and photo-
graphs of the CW machine are given. At a current of tip to
300.000
amp the p,--oductivity of the machine amounts to 100- 125 welding
Card 1/2 operationE per hour. As a result of tivesligations
carried out to
Condenser-discharge Welding of Bicycle Frames
SOV/137-58-11-22732
determine optimal conditions for CW, relationships were
established between the
strcnpth of the welded joints and the current density, the
charge potential, the com-
pression force, the overhang of the pipe, etc. (the data are
compiled in the form of
diagrams). Vibration- strength tests yielded favorable
results. A prototype of an
industrial CW machine was designed and constructed. The
employment of the CW
technique reduces the labor from 41-44 to 5-15 minutes pt!r
frame and lowers the
co:st of manufacture per frame from 12-13 to 5-7 rubles.

TITLE: Colored lyar r
0 y1 sate @/based on certain dthydroxygnthrIgAggMep
SOURCE: Vywokomolekulyarnyye soyedinenlys, v. 7, no. 9, 1965,
1543-1548
TOPIC TAGS: polyaryl aster, polymerization color, heat resistant
ABSTRACT: To eliminate the-dyeing step and to improve colorfastness,
Intrinsicalir
colored polyaryl enters have been synthesized from
dihydroxyanthraquiLnones, viz.,
alizarin, quinizarin, and quinizarin blue. Such starting materials
were also of
interest from the standpoint of the effect of repeat-unit structure
on polymer
iproperties, and because such polymers could be modified by
treatment with metal
salts. Homo- and co-polymeric polyaryl esters were prepared from the
d1hydrozy-
anthraquinones and torephthelic and Isophthalic acids, and
phenolphthalein by
i polycondensation In high boiling solvents. It was found that homo-
and co
polymeric polyaryl eaters from quinizarin and terephthelic or
Isophthalic ;cids,
and from alizarin blue and terephthalic acid have high softening
points# sogto
475-500C for the polymer from quitkizarin and torephthalle- acid.
Gopolymeric
carj 1/2
L 1968-66
ACCUSION NRt APS022599
~
polyaryl eaters from the dihydroxyanthrequinones and
phenolphthalein had good
;aolublVty in organic solvents and could be readily cast from
solution to form
HIMIA~ Such film were colored, strong (800-4200 kg/cm2) and
elastic (10-15%).
Film color could be modified by adding the appropriate metal
salt to the polymr
solution. Orig. art. host 3 formulas, 3 figures, and 2 tables.
